When it comes to trusted names in Queensland, the Royal Automobile Club of Queensland Limited (RACQ) stands out as a pillar of community support, reliability, and exceptional service. As Queensland’s largest club and a proud mutual organisation, RACQ has been providing essential services like roadside assistance, insurance, banking, and travel for decades—serving over 1.75 million members across the Sunshine State.

The Road Ahead: Queensland’s Most Read Magazine
RACQ’s commitment to informing and inspiring the community extends to The Road Ahead, its bi-monthly member magazine. With a combined circulation of over 1.2 million copies (print and digital), it is Queensland’s highest circulating publication. From travel tips and road safety advice to motoring news and lifestyle stories, The Road Ahead keeps members informed, connected, and entertained.
Driving Road Safety Education
RACQ takes road safety seriously—especially when it comes to young Queenslanders. The club delivers free road safety education programs to primary and secondary schools throughout the state. This proactive approach to education empowers the next generation to be safer and more responsible on our roads.
